简易 服务器 文件python
SSM框架项目结构目录以及配置文件
一、基于Idea集成环境Maven管理的Web项目创建 1、新建一个project 2、补充好项目结构(这里其实可以通过配置来补充,生成之后就是完整的项目目录结构),这里要是自己创建完之后,要是文件不像这种样式的,需要自己改一下文件类型 注意一定要配置好webapp路径 3、配置Tomcat 完成以 ......
QFileDialog 读取文件目录+文件内容
一、效果 二、模版 1 connect(ui->pushButton, &QPushButton::clicked, [=](){//连接按钮点击信号 2 //打开目录 3 QString filePath = QFileDialog::getOpenFileName(this, "标题栏题目", ......
Conda管理Python版本
查看Python版本 查看当前环境的Python版本 conda activate && python -V 查看指定环境 conda activate test && python -V 创建Python环境 先搜索conda有哪些python版本 conda search --full --na ......
使用 ABAP + OLE 消费 Windows DLL 文件里的代码和服务
在 SAP ABAP 中,我们可以使用 OLE (Object Linking and Embedding) 技术来实现对 Windows DLL 文件的代码和服务的消费。以下是一个详细的解决方案: 首先,我们需要明确 OLE 技术在 ABAP 中的应用。OLE 是由微软开发的一种技术,它允许对象( ......
35文本文件的读写
一、最后效果 二、代码: 1 procedure TForm1.Button1Click(Sender: TObject); 2 begin 3 if OpenDialog1.Execute then 4 Edit1.Text:=OpenDialog1.FileName; 5 end; 6 7 8 ......
Spartacus ngsw-config.json 文件内容的详细解释
以下是 Spartacus 项目 ngsw-config.json文件的代码解释和示例: `index`: "/index.html", index: 定义了服务工作线程 (Service Worker) 中的主页文件。在这个例子中,index 设置为/index.html,表示在缓存策略中将会使用 ......
关于 Angular 项目里 ngsw-config.json 文件的作用
ngsw-config.json 文件是Angular Service Worker的配置文件,用于配置Angular Service Worker(ngsw)的行为。Service Worker 是一个用于创建离线体验和缓存策略的技术,它允许您的应用在离线状态下继续运行,提高性能并实现“渐进式网络 ......
python 赋值、浅拷贝、深拷贝的区别
b = a: 赋值引用,a 和 b 都指向同一个对象。 b = a.copy(): 浅拷贝, a 和 b 是一个独立的对象,但他们的子对象还是指向统一对象(是引用)。 b = copy.deepcopy(a): 深度拷贝, a 和 b 完全拷贝了父对象及其子对象,两者是完全独立的。 对于可变的序列, ......
python:第十九章:数据类型之None
一,什么是None? None表示空值,其类型为NoneType, 内存中值为None的对象是同一个实例 1 2 3 4 5 6 7 8 9 # None的类型 print("None的类型:",type(None)) # 输出 <class 'NoneType'> # 值为None的对象是同一个实 ......
python:第二十章:数据类型转换之bool
一,如何得到对象的布尔值? Python中,所有的数据都是对象,如整数、浮点数、字符串、列表、字典等。每个对象都有一个布尔值,用于表示对象的真假内置函数bool()能用来获取对象的布尔值。它把对象转换为布尔值,返回True或False,表示对象为真或假 看例子:非0数字的布尔值为True,0的布尔值 ......
python:第十八章:比较运算符
一,比较运算符是什么? 用于比较两个值的运算符。 作用: 对两个值进行比较,并返回一个布尔值(True或False)作为比较的结果 1,比较运算符有哪些 主要有六种比较运算符: 小于(<) 小于等于(<=) 大于(>) 大于等于(>=) 等于(==) 不等于(!=) 2,字符串的比较规则: 按字母的 ......
python:第十六章:赋值运算符
一,什么是赋值运算符? 赋值运算符的执行顺序 赋值运算符 = 它用来把值赋给变量。 运算符右边的表达式先计算得到结果,再将结果赋值给左边的变量 1 2 3 4 5 # 赋值 x = 5 y = x + 3 print("x=", x) print("y=", y) 运行结果: x= 5 y= 8 二 ......
python:第十七章:布尔运算符(逻辑运算符)
一,布尔运算符有哪些? and运算是与运算,只有两个值都为True,and运算结果才是True,如下表 a b a and b True True True True False False False True False False False False or运算是或运算,只要其中有一个值为T ......
Python博客作业3
import turtle import datetime import time def draw_gap(): # 绘制数码间隔 turtle.penup() turtle.fd(5) def draw_line(draw): # 绘制单段数码管 draw_gap() turtle.pendow ......
c++ 列出当前目录下的目录与文件
#include <iostream> #include <dirent.h> #include <cstring> #include <fstream> #include <sstream> #include <string> using namespace std; std::string li ......
【chatgpt】传输文件列表到客户端
传输文件列表到客户端时,常见的分割方式有以下几种选择: 使用换行符分割:使用每行一个文件名的方式,每个文件名之间使用换行符进行分割。这是最简单和常见的方式,易于处理和解析。 使用逗号分割:将每个文件名使用逗号进行分割。这样的格式可以方便地用逗号分割字符串的函数进行处理,但是如果文件名中包含逗号可能会 ......
如何删除已创建的docker容器中的文件夹
问题 我通过docker cp命令把'apache-maven-3.9.5'文件夹复制进了jenkins的容器中。但是当我想删除时却发现没有权限了。 过程 进去容器执行rm -rf /usr/local/apache-maven-3.9.5无效。没权限!!! 在容器外执行'docker exec 容 ......
Java解析上传的zip文件--包含Excel解析与图片上传
Java解析上传的zip文件--包含Excel解析与图片上传 前言:今天遇到一个需求:上传一个zip格式的压缩文件,该zip中包含人员信息的excel以及excel中每行对应的人的图片,现在需要将该zip压缩包中所有内容解析导入到数据库中,包括图片,并将图片与excel内容对应。 代码演示: /** ......
Linux 中 shell脚本统计fasta文件中每一条染色体的长度
001、 借助数组实现 [root@pc1 test]# ls a.fa [root@pc1 test]# cat a.fa ## 测试fasta文件 >chr1 aattccgg ttcc >chr2 ttccc >chr3 tttc cct ## 统计脚本 [root@pc1 test]# aw ......
代码随想训练营第三十七天(Python)| 738.单调递增的数字、968.监控二叉树
738.单调递增的数字 class Solution: def monotoneIncreasingDigits(self, n: int) -> int: # 主要思路当前数字比前面数字小时。前面数字 -1,当前数字变2为 9 str_n = str(n) for i in range(len(s ......
代码训练营第三十八天(Python)| 509. 斐波那契数、70. 爬楼梯、746. 使用最小花费爬楼梯
509. 斐波那契数 1、动态规划 class Solution: def fib(self, n: int) -> int: if n <= 1: return n # dp[i] 代表第 i 个数的斐波那契值 dp = [0] * (n+1) dp[0] = 0 dp[1] = 1 for i ......
Linux 中shell脚本实现给fasta文件中重复的染色体名做序号标记
001、测试数据 [root@pc1 test]# ls a.txt [root@pc1 test]# cat a.txt ## 测试数据 >jcf7180003470556 2 7 >jcf7180003470556 3 8 >jcf7180003470552 4 9 6 >jcf71800034 ......
Java文件处理(二):文件读写
读/写文件前请保证文件存在。 InputStream InputStream是基本的输入流,它是一个抽象类(不是接口) 最基本的方法是int read(),作用是读取输入流的下一个字节,并返回字节的int值,返回-1代表已读到结尾。 按字节读取一个文件流: public void readFile( ......
微服务 Feign 最佳实践
代码示例: ① 创建一个名为 feign-api 的模块,引入 feign 的 starter 依赖 ② 将 order-service 中编写的 UserClient、User 都剪切到 feign-api 模块中 ③ 在 order-service 中引入 feign-api 模块的依赖 ④ 修 ......
Python 使用 MQTT
官方参考文档:https://docs.emqx.com/zh/cloud/latest/connect_to_deployments/python_sdk.html 参考文档:https://zhuanlan.zhihu.com/p/187481769 发布消息 首先定义一个 while 循环语句 ......
linux各目录存放文件类型
/usr 最庞大的目录,要用到的应用程序和文件几乎都在这个目录。其中包含:/usr/X11R6 存放X window的目录/usr/bin 众多的应用程序/usr/sbin 超级用户的一些管理程序/usr/doc linux文档/usr/include linux下开发和编译应用程序所需要的头文件/ ......
CVE-2023-4357 Chrome任意文件读取 [漏洞复现]
CVE-2023-4357 Chrome任意文件读取 >漏洞描述 由于未充分验证 XML 中不受信任的输入,远程攻击者可利用该漏洞通过构建的 HTML 页面绕过文件访问限制,导致chrome任意文件读取。 漏洞复现 > 影响版本 Google Chrome < 116.0.5845.96 proxy ......
在Rider 中使用Entity Framework Core UI 插件创建EFCore 的 Migration迁移文件时报错
报错信息 EF Core tools are required to execute this action 在点击报错信息中的发Fix进行安装时,再次出错 这次是提示版本不匹配 这里我使用的是EF Core 7.0.14版本的 报错原因 没有安装 dotnet tool 点击Fix进行安装时,是安 ......
重构人与服务链路 新服务生态渐成气候
最近,国内手机大厂纷纷加入了“百模大战”。在折叠屏之外,大模型又成为手机高端化增量的新契机。 智能手机市场在低谷徘徊了几年,AI有望成为新的激活要素。但AI给手机带来的变化到底是什么呢?在2023 OPPO开发者大会(ODC23)上,OPPO向我们展现了融合大模型能力的全新ColorOS 14,以及 ......